Judge Dismisses Rumsfeld Torture Suit
A federal judge has dismissed a lawsuit against former Defense Secretary Donald Rumsfeld for the torture of prisoners in US custody overseas. The American Civil Liberties Union and Human Rights First had brought the case on behalf of nine former prisoners in Iraq and Afghanistan. The suit said Rumsfeld had tacitly or directly authorized a series of abuses including beatings, stabbings, shocks, burnings and sexual humiliation. In his dismissal ruling, U.S. District Judge Thomas Hogan acknowledged the men had been tortured. But he said they do not have constitutional rights to seek redress and that government officials are immune.

Business Use of Terror-Watch List Shutting Out Innocent Customers
A civil rights group is reporting an increasing number of innocent people are being denied transactions by businesses checking their names against the Treasury Department’s terrorist watch list. The Lawyers Committee for Civil Rights says credit bureaus, health insurers, car dealerships, employers and landlords have denied business to customers bearing similar names to those on the six-thousand plus list. In one case, a California man was denied a home loan after his credit report flagged his middle name, Hassan, as an alias for one of Saddam Hussein’s sons.
